Ordinals
beta
Sat 1838334128992581
decimal
631334.378992581
degree
0°1334′326″378992581‴
percentile
87.53972052451188%
name
avdzqyqwleq
cycle
0
epoch
3
period
313
block
631334
offset
378992581
timestamp
2020-05-22 18:19:56 UTC
rarity
common
prev
next